gpt4 book ai didi

coldfusion - 使用组时如何查找嵌套的cfoutput记录计数

转载 作者:行者123 更新时间:2023-12-02 05:49:30 25 4
gpt4 key购买 nike

考虑以下:

<cfoutput query="resources" group="type">
<h4>#type#</h4>
<cfoutput>
#name#
</cfoutput>
</cfoutput>
resources.recordcount会给我记录的总数,但是有没有一种优雅的方法来找出嵌套数据的记录数?例如
<cfoutput query="resources" group="type">
<h4>#type# (#noofrecords# of #resources.recordcount#)</h4>
<cfoutput>
#name#
</cfoutput>
</cfoutput>

我可能可以用循环来做一些 hacky 的事情,但想知道是否有专门使用 cfoutput 组来做到这一点的方法。

最佳答案

您可以先进行输出以获取计数。这将比执行查询查询更有效。

<cfoutput query="resources" group="type">
<cfset noofrecords= 0>
<cfoutput>
<cfset noofrecords++>
</cfoutput>
<h4>#type# (#noofrecords# of #resources.recordcount#)</h4>
<cfoutput>
#name#
</cfoutput>
</cfoutput>

关于coldfusion - 使用组时如何查找嵌套的cfoutput记录计数,我们在Stack Overflow上找到一个类似的问题: https://stackoverflow.com/questions/26798463/

25 4 0
Copyright 2021 - 2024 cfsdn All Rights Reserved 蜀ICP备2022000587号
广告合作:1813099741@qq.com 6ren.com